Output 21d4525a81f9fc3a0e03fc44e616e18dd1a76e122d79a71c51a9c119163c12ec:1

value
1612101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 070c98785ca50f266e8cc08be318e38d90ff6a72 OP_EQUAL
address
32LHk3To74vNxF4uRhdJ64KVxWKUpe9L2c
transaction
21d4525a81f9fc3a0e03fc44e616e18dd1a76e122d79a71c51a9c119163c12ec
spent
true